Abstract

We proposed a highly scattering optical transmission (HSOT) polymer and applied it to a light pipe of a backlighting system for liquid crystal displays. Although the HSOT polymer backlighting system was composed of fewer parts than those of the conventional transparent one, the HSOT polymer backlighting system showed not only twice the brightness but also twice the efficiency of the conventional one. In addition, the HSOT polymer backlighting system had no degradation of color uniformity due to scattering in the HSOT polymer.
